Life is a series of vital questions:
“What should I choose for a career?”
“Should I ask her to marry me?”
“What should we name our baby?”
“What job offer should I take?”
“How do I prepare for retirement?”

Thankfully, not all decisions are that critical; still , we know from God’s Word that He cares about the things that concern us and the decisions we face each day, both big and small. The Father of all creation is intimately concerned about the details. Jesus said, ‘But the very hairs of your head are numbered’—Mt. 10:30
He understands everything about us:’… for your heavenly Father knoweth that ye h ave need of all these things.’—Mt. 6:32
He desires to provide for our needs:’ If that is how God clothes the grass of the field, … will he not much more clothe you?—Mt.6:30
He cares about every choice you make: ‘ For this God is our God for ever and ever:He will be our guide…’—Psalm 48:14
More importantly, He wants us to make decisions that reflect His will. ‘Therefore do not be foolish, but understand what the Lord's will is.’—Eph 5:17


Often I’m asked. “How can I know what God’s will is for my life?

Here are 3 Basic Principles directly from His Word that have helped me tremendously through the years:

1. GOD’S WILL IS AVAILABLE ONLY THROUGH THE LORD JESUS
Today, billions of people seek goodness, knowledge, hope and guidance through many different rituals and beliefs. Too many regard Jesus Christ as just “another’ good man or pious teacher in life’s religious smorgasbord! The Savior, however, proclaimed Himself in a clear-cut way that leaves no room for interpretation:…”I am the way, the truth and the life; no man cometh unto the Father; but by me”—John 14:6
God has a plan for your life, and Jesus has sent the Holy Spirit, as promised, to reveal God’s will to you; But when he, the Spirit of truth, comes, he will guide you into all truth.—Jn.16:13.Now, it is up to each of us to seek His divine guidance for our life and say, ‘Lead me in thy truth, and teach me; for thou art the God of my salvation....—Psalm25:5

2. TO KNOW GOD’S WILL, YOU MUST OFFER YOURSELF TO GOD
To Apostle Paul writes: Therefore, I urge you, brothers, in view of God's mercy, to offer your bodies as living sacrifices, holy and pleasing to God—this is your spiritual act of worship.—Romans 12:1
The Bible declares that if you surrender your body to God and live a holy life, it will be acceptable to Him. Notice that ‘holy’ and ‘acceptable’ go together… God will not accept anything unholy. God wants us to be living sacrifices unto Him.
Some people say, “Lord, I will be Yours when I die.” God says, ‘No, I want you when you are alive, because when you die your body goes to dust. I cannot use it”
This means we must be willing to be used by Him as a “reasonable service.” This act of worship brings pleasure and glory to god. Upon this foundation, we can know God’s will as the Holy Spirit lives through us.

3. TO KNOW GOD’S WILL, YOUR MIND MUST BE RENEWED SUPERNATURALLY
Romans 12:2 points to an astounding truth: Do not conform any longer to the pattern of this world, but be transformed by the renewing of your mind. Then you will be able to test and approve what God's will is—his good, pleasing and perfect will.
The word transformed in the Greek language is where we get the word metamorphose, as when a caterpillar becomes a butterfly…
As you consistently present your body and mind to God by spending time with Him and reading His Word, then He can begin to transform you from the inside out. Every middle school science student learns that the transformation of anything, even the smallest cell, must begin in the nucleus, or innermost part. Spiritually, that can only happen when you commit yourself to Him—body, soul and spirit. The Holy spirit then shows us His will, something no man can teach you!


FINDING GOD’S GOOD, ACCEPTABLE AND PERFECT WILL
Something wonderful happens when you present yourself to the Savior, “… that ye may prove what is that good, and acceptable, and perfect, will of God’—Romans 12:2
God’s will is progressive. We are introduced to his good will. Then , as we progress in him, we find His acceptable will… As we continue to develop in the spirit, we come into His perfect will! Nobody knows His perfect will right away.. It is a process…
And it is His perfect will that causes us to avoid mistakes and know the mind of Christ in our decisions. This should increasingly take place as the Christian Life develops. The more we know Him, through spending time in the Word and in His presence, The more we progress toward knowing His perfect will.
The word ‘perfect’ means complete: God doesn’t stop halfway! When He saves, He saves to the uttermost. When He heals, He heals totally. He seeks to bring us into complete wisdom and righteousness.
